Applies to

  • BlueXP
  • Cloud Volumes ONTAP (CVO)

Answer

  • Yes. When the capacity management mode is set to automatic in the BlueXP Connector settings, BlueXP takes care of purchasing new disks for the CVO instances when more capacity is required.
  • If the aggregate reaches the capacity threshold and if more disks can be added to the particular aggregate, then BlueXP will automatically purchase new disks for the aggregate to ensure that the volume can continue to grow.
  • If an aggregate reaches the capacity threshold and cannot support any additional disks, BlueXP automatically moves a volume from that aggregate to an aggregate with available capacity or creates a new aggregate.
